DeepMind vs. Google Brain: A Battle for AI Supremacy
DeepMind and Google Brain, two leading forces in the field of artificial intelligence, are engaged in a fierce battle for supremacy. Both teams boast groundbreaking achievements, pushing the boundaries of what AI can achieve. DeepMind, known for its complex approaches, has made waves with AlphaGo and AlphaZero, demonstrating remarkable proficiency in problem solving. Conversely, Google Brain, leveraging its vast infrastructure, has achieved significant strides in machine learning, powering applications like Google Assistant and object detection.
The rivalry between these two giants is not just about bragging rights. It fuels innovation, driving the rapid progress of AI and its influence on society. The outcome of this race will undoubtedly shape the future of artificial intelligence and its role in our future.
When Algorithms Collide: Significant Implications of AI vs. AI
In a future increasingly shaped by artificial intelligence, the potential for conflict between autonomous systems is a burgeoning concern. Envision a world where sophisticated algorithms, each designed with distinct objectives, collide. The consequences of such collisions could be profound, raising complex ethical dilemmas about responsibility, bias, and the very nature of intelligence.
- One concern arises from the potential for conflicting goals. Two AI systems, programmed to optimize different metrics, may arrive at mutually contradictory solutions.
- Additionally, the inherent complexity of AI processes can make it challenging to foresee the outcomes of such interactions.
- In essence, navigating the ethical realm of AI vs. AI demands a careful analysis of potential risks and the development of robust safeguards to minimize harm.
Will Artificial Intelligence Surpass Our Mastery?
As artificial intelligence evolves at an unprecedented pace, a fundamental question emerges: will AI inevitably outstrip human control? Increasingly experts believe that the rapid progression of AI technologies poses a potential threat to our preeminence over machines. The potential of AI to learn, adapt, and conceivably make independent decisions raises concerns about unintended consequences and the danger of AI operating in ways that are perilous to humanity.
- Nevertheless, proponents of AI argue that with careful regulation, AI can be a powerful tool for good, solving some of the world's most pressing challenges. They posit that by augmenting human intelligence, AI can lead to discoveries in fields such as medicine, climate change, and space exploration.
- Ultimately, the question of whether AI will outpace human control remains a matter of debate. It is imperative that we engage in a thoughtful and informed dialogue about the ethical, social, and economic implications of AI to ensure that its advancement benefits all of humanity.
